Acoustic studies of voice-onset-time in aphasics' speech suggest that fluent aphasics' errors are misselected phonemic targets whereas nonfluent aphasics' errors are of articulatory origin. However, we must be cautious when extrapolating a theory from only one measure of articulation. In this experiment, I examined utterances produced by five fluent aphasics, five nonfluent aphasics and two controls. First, the voice-onset-time findings were replicated. Second, I examined the duration of vowels preceding word-final stop consonants as an index of the consonant's voicing category. The pattern of voice-onset-times produced did not predict the pattern of vowel durations. Thus, voice-onset-time cannot be used to characterize more generally the output of the speaker.
